先检查插件是否正确安装并确认路径无误,再验证兼容性与依赖环境,重启软件并清除缓存后,通过命令面板测试功能,最后查看控制台报错定位问题。

Sublime插件安装后不生效,通常不是插件本身的问题,而是环境配置、权限或加载机制出现异常。遇到这种情况,先别急着重装软件或系统,按以下步骤排查基本都能解决。
检查插件是否正确安装
确保插件已经真正被加载到 Sublime Text 中:
- 打开菜单栏 Preferences → Package Control,查看已安装的插件列表中是否有目标插件。
- 进入 Sublime 安装目录下的 Packages 或 Installed Packages 文件夹,确认插件文件夹存在。
- 如果是手动安装,检查插件是否放在正确的路径下(用户目录下的
Packages文件夹)。
确认插件依赖和兼容性
很多插件对 Sublime 版本或操作系统有要求:
- 查看插件文档,确认是否支持你当前使用的 Sublime Text 版本(如 ST3 还是 ST4)。
- 某些插件依赖 Python 插件环境或外部工具(如 Node.js、Git),需确保这些依赖已安装并加入系统 PATH。
- 比如 Emmet 或 JsFormat 需要 Node 支持,若未配置则无法运行。
重启 Sublime 并清除缓存
有时候插件未加载是因为缓存问题:
- 完全退出 Sublime Text,重新启动。
- 删除 Data/Cache 目录下的内容(路径在
Preferences → Browse Packages上一级)。 - 再次尝试调用插件命令,看是否恢复正常。
检查快捷键和命令冲突
插件功能可能已被触发,但没有明显反馈:
- 使用 Command Palette(Ctrl+Shift+P 或 Cmd+Shift+P)输入插件名称,看能否找到对应命令。
- 检查快捷键设置:进入 Preferences → Key Bindings,搜索相关键位,避免与其他插件或默认操作冲突。
- 可尝试手动绑定一个新快捷键测试插件是否可用。
查看控制台报错信息
Sublime 的控制台能提供关键线索:
- 按下 Ctrl + ` 打开控制台。
- 观察是否有红色错误提示,尤其是关于插件导入失败、语法错误或模块缺失的信息。
- 常见错误如
ImportError: No module named xxx表示缺少依赖库。 - 根据错误信息针对性处理,例如重装插件、更新依赖或修复 Python 脚本路径。










